BONE, Muirhead
Bone was born in Glasgow and studied at Glasgow School of Art. He settled in London in 1901. He was an official war artist in 1916-1918, and the official Admiralty artist in 1939-1946. As one of Britain’s leading draughtsmen, he was renowned for the almost photographic detail he achieved in his drawings. As well as recording the First World War on the Front, Bone spent time on the Clyde in Scotland, documenting shipbuilding. Bone was knighted in 1937.
